Attic Painting in Wilmington, NC
Attic painting services involve applying fresh paint to the interior surfaces of a home's attic space, including walls, ceilings, and any exposed framing. These projects typically focus on enhancing the appearance of the attic, protecting surfaces from wear and moisture, or preparing the space for future use such as storage or conversion into a living area. Homeowners often request attic painting to improve lighting, create a cleaner look, or address any existing paint damage caused by humidity or age.
Before requesting attic painting,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the project, including surface preparation, types of paint suitable for attic environments, and any necessary repairs such as patching or sanding. It’s also helpful to consider ventilation and moisture control, especially in attics prone to humidity, to ensure the longevity of the paint job and maintain a healthy space. Clarifying these details can help ensure the results meet expectations and contribute to a well-maintained attic space.

Common Attic Painting Jobs
Attic ceiling painting - refreshes the look of attic spaces with a clean, finished appearance.
Vapor barrier painting - protects against moisture and improves attic insulation performance.
Insulation coating - enhances energy efficiency by sealing gaps and reducing heat transfer.
Structural painting - helps maintain the integrity of attic beams and framing with protective coatings.
Mildew and mold resistant painting - prevents growth in humid attic environments for healthier air quality.
Custom color and finish options - allows for personalized attic aesthetics to match home decor.
Attic Painting Questions
What types of attic painting projects are common? Attic painting often includes walls, ceilings, and trim to refresh the space or improve aesthetics.
Is attic painting suitable for insulation or roofing? No, attic painting focuses on interior surfaces and does not include insulation or roofing work.
What should be considered before painting an attic? Proper surface preparation and ventilation are important to ensure a smooth finish and long-lasting results.
Can attic painting help improve the appearance of a finished attic space? Yes, updating paint can enhance the look and feel of a finished or unfinished attic area.
